Review Of Medicare Supplement Policies
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ans to choose from. These insurance plans are controlled by the US government Medicare and are designed to work with Initial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are does not cover in full (the 20% that is left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a insurance plan letter A-N. Because the plans are standardized and controlled, the advantages are precisely the same no matter what business is offering the Medigap insurance. The only difference between precisely the same Medigap insurance plan letter with firms that are different is the cost. For instance, a Plan F with Aetna and a Plan F with AARP are just the same the only difference between them is the cost that the insurance companies bill.. .. Medigap Insurance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is one of the very popular supplement insurance plans. This Medigap plan covers 100% of all that is left over by Original Medicare. By way of example, F covers all hospital bills, the Part A deductible, and something that occurs in a physician ‘s office or every other medical facility at 100%. This really is the only plan that offers complete coverage that is all-inclusive to 100%.
Medigap Insurance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a insurance plan we like to recommend the most and frequently referred to as the Gold Plan. It truly is almost identical to Plan F. The only difference is an annual de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the benefits are just the same as Plan F. The reason we like Plan G is because the premiums are much less than Plan F.
Medigap Insurance Plan N
Unless you’re admitted plan N does have a $50 copay at the ER, an office copay of 0 to $20, Part B deductible of $166, and Part B excess costs aren’t covered.. .. This plan is not bad for individuals who would like to appreciate a premium that is lower still have nearly total coverage at the hospital and other medical bills that are high that can happen.

When Is The Best Time To Purchase A Medigap Plan?
The best time to buy Medicare Supplement Plan is when you are first eligible for Medicare; for Medigap during your open enrollment. During this time which starts six months before your 65th birthday and continue for six months after your 65th birthday it is possible to sign up regardless of your health for a Medicare Supplement Plan. There aren’t any questions for preexisting states and you’ll be able to get any Medigap plan you need from any carrier
In case you are looking get an idea for the first time or to alter plans and past the age of 65 you may need to answer some fundamental health questions to qualify. Most people and qualify so you should still be able to get a plan.
